Real Name: Alfredo James Pacino
Height: 5' 6" Tall
Born On: April 25, 1940
Birth Place: New York, New York, USA
Profession: actor, director, writer, producer
Education: High School for the Performing Arts, NYC (dropped out)
Education: HB Studio, NYC (studied with Charles Laughton)
Education: Actors Studio, NYC
Dated: Beverly D'Angelo
Dated: Penelope Ann Miller
Dated: Jan Tarrant
Dated: Diane Keaton
Child: Anton James
Child: Olivia Rose , Julie Marie

FilmSalary
S1m0ne (2002) $11,000,000
The Godfather: Part III (1990) $5,000,000
The Godfather: Part II (1974) $500,000 and 10% of the gross after break-even
The Godfather (1972) $35,000

Al Pacino MAJOR FILM AWARDS
source:IMDB
Academy AwardsYearResultAwardCategoryMovie1993 Won Oscar Best Actor in a Leading Role Scent of a Woman-1992
1993 Nominated Oscar Best Actor in a Supporting Role Glengarry Glen Ross-1992
1991 Nominated Oscar Best Actor in a Supporting Role Dick Tracy-1990
1980 Nominated Oscar Best Actor in a Leading Role ...And Justice for All.-1979
1976 Nominated Oscar Best Actor in a Leading Role Dog Day Afternoon-1975
1975 Nominated Oscar Best Actor in a Leading Role The Godfather: Part II-1974
1974 Nominated Oscar Best Actor in a Leading Role Serpico-1973
1973 Nominated Oscar Best Actor in a Supporting Role The Godfather-1972
